Understanding Mobile-First Content

Mobile-first content refers to the approach of designing and creating content that is optimized for mobile devices first, and then adapted for desktop and other devices. This approach is crucial in Kenya, where mobile penetration is high, and most users are accessing the internet through their mobile phones.

Mobile-first content is not just about responsiveness; it’s about creating an immersive and engaging user experience that is tailored to the unique characteristics of mobile devices. This includes short-form content, easy-to-navigate interfaces, and fast loading speeds.

How to Implement Mobile-First Content in Kenya

Implementing mobile-first content Kenya requires a strategic approach. Here are some tips to get you started:

Design for Thumb-Friendly Interfaces: Design your content to be easily accessible and navigable on mobile devices. Use thumb-friendly interfaces, and ensure that your CTAs are prominent and easily clickable.

Optimize for Short-Form Content: Mobile users have shorter attention spans, so it’s essential to create short-form content that’s easy to consume. Use bite-sized paragraphs, and break up long-form content into smaller, easily digestible sections.

Prioritize Fast Loading Speeds: Mobile users expect fast loading speeds, so it’s essential to optimize your website and content for speed. Use caching, compress images, and leverage browser caching to improve loading speeds.

Mobile-First Content in Kenya: Key Statistics and Insights

In a country where mobile devices account for over 90% of internet access, it’s crucial to prioritize mobile-first content in Kenya. The following table highlights key statistics and insights to inform your content strategy.

Statistic Value Source
Mobile internet penetration in Kenya 93% Hootsuite, 2022
Average mobile data speed in Kenya 15.4 Mbps OpenSignal, 2022
Most popular mobile devices in Kenya Tecno, Samsung, and Infinix Kenyans.co.ke, 2022
Mobile-first content preference among Kenyan consumers 80% Google, 2020
Average mobile screen size in Kenya 5.5 inches DeviceAtlas, 2022

What is mobile-first content, and why is it important in Kenya?

Mobile-first content refers to content optimized for mobile devices, considering the unique characteristics of mobile users in Kenya. It’s essential because most Kenyans access the internet primarily through their mobile phones, making mobile optimization crucial for reaching and engaging with your target audience.

How do I create mobile-friendly content for my Kenyan audience?

To create mobile-friendly content, focus on concise, scannable, and visually appealing content. Use short paragraphs, headings, and bullet points to make your content easy to consume on smaller screens. Don’t forget to optimize your images and videos for mobile devices.

Can I use the same content for both desktop and mobile users in Kenya?

While you can use similar content, it’s recommended to tailor your content specifically for mobile users in Kenya. Mobile users have different needs, behaviors, and preferences compared to desktop users, so adapt your content to cater to these differences.

How do I optimize my content for mobile search in Kenya?

To optimize your content for mobile search in Kenya, ensure your website is mobile-friendly, loads quickly, and has relevant, high-quality content that answers the user’s query. Also, use long-tail keywords and phrases that Kenyan mobile users are likely to search for.

What role does page speed play in mobile-first content in Kenya?

Page speed is crucial for mobile-first content in Kenya, as slow-loading pages can lead to high bounce rates and a poor user experience. Aim for a page speed of under 3 seconds to ensure your mobile users can access your content quickly and easily.

How can I measure the success of my mobile-first content in Kenya?

To measure the success of your mobile-first content, track metrics such as mobile traffic, engagement, bounce rates, and conversion rates. Use tools like Google Analytics to gain insights into your mobile users’ behavior and adjust your content strategy accordingly.
